Step 1: Initial Assessment
We’ll start by conducting a thorough assessment of your property to identify the source of the leak. Our experienced technicians will use specialized equipment to detect any signs of moisture or water damage, such as water stains or warping.
Step 2: Leak Detection
Using state-of-the-art equipment, we’ll pinpoint the location of the leak and find out the extent of the damage. This may involve using thermal imaging cameras or acoustic sensors to detect even the smallest leaks.
Step 3: Repair and Restoration
Once we’ve located the leak, we’ll work quickly to repair it and restore your property to its original condition. This may involve replacing damaged materials, installing new fixtures, or repairing structural damage.
Step 4: Cleaning and Drying
Finally, we’ll clean and dry your property to prevent any further damage or mold growth. This may involve using specialized equipment to remove standing water and moisture from your home.

Warning Signs You Need Leak Detection Services
Ignoring the warning signs can lead to costly disasters. Don’t wait until it’s too late. Here are some common signs that you need leak detection services: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
A musty smell in your home can be a sign of a hidden leak. If you notice a persistent odor, it’s time to call in the experts. Don’t ignore the smell as it can be a sign of mold growth or other health hazards.
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ls
Water stains can be a sign of a leaky roof or pipe. If you notice water stains on your ceiling or walls, it’s time to investigate further. Don’t delay as the damage can spread quickly.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of a hidden leak. If you notice any changes in your flooring, it’s time to call in the experts. Don’t wait as the damage can be extensive.
Increased Water Bills
If your water bills are suddenly higher than usual, it could be a sign of a hidden leak. Don’t assume it’s just a spike in usage as it could be a sign of a more serious issue.
Visible Signs of Water Damage
Visible signs of water damage, such as mineral deposits or rust, can be a sign of a hidden leak. Don’t ignore the signs as they can show a more serious issue.
